New Chaos Ransomware Builder Variant "Yashma" Discovered in the Wild

image credit: adobe stock

Cybersecurity researchers have disclosed details of the latest version of the Chaos ransomware line, dubbed Yashma.

“Though Chaos ransomware builder has only been in the wild for a year, Yashma claims to be the sixth version (v6.0) of this malware,” BlackBerry research and intelligence team said in a report shared with The Hacker News.

Chaos is a customizable ransomware builder that emerged in underground forums on June 9, 2021, by falsely marketing itself as the .NET version of Ryuk despite sharing no such overlaps with the notorious counterpart.
